About Dance Shop Listings

Typical dance shops carry ballet, ballroom, Latin, jazz and tap shoes alongside leotards, skirts, tights, practice wear and accessories such as bags and shoe-care items. Many serve particular disciplines or exam syllabuses, and some provide fitting services, which is especially important for children's and pointe shoes. Ranges usually cover all ages and levels, from first classes through to competition and performance. Some shops concentrate on everyday practice kit while others also stock costumes and competition wear.

Choosing Dance Shop

When choosing a dance shop, make sure it stocks the shoes, brands and uniform your class or exam board requires. Ask whether they offer fitting, particularly for growing children and for pointe shoes, and check the returns or exchange policy in case sizing is off. If you need items for a specific show or exam date, ask about availability, ordering times and click-and-collect. Location and opening hours matter too if you may need something at short notice.

Frequently Asked Questions

What should I wear to a beginner dance class?

Comfortable clothes you can move freely in and appropriate smooth-soled shoes are usually enough to begin; staff at a dance shop can recommend suitable footwear. Confirm with your teacher, as some classes set specific requirements.

How much does a dance class usually cost?

In the UK a single group class commonly costs from a few pounds up to around fifteen pounds, with block bookings often cheaper per session. Shoes and dancewear are an additional cost that a dance shop can help with.

Which dance is best for beginners?

Simple styles like salsa, jive or basic ballroom are popular first choices because they have easy foundations and plenty of beginner classes. A dance shop can fit you with the right shoes once you have chosen.

Is dancing good for heart failure?

Gentle dancing can offer light, enjoyable exercise and is sometimes used in cardiac rehabilitation, but it depends on your health. Anyone with heart failure should seek advice from their GP or cardiologist before starting.
